Size

Bunk beds are a great solution for rooms with kids that are tight on space. In addition to saving floor area, bunk beds can help create a sense of space and adventure for kids. Before you purchase bunk beds for children there are some factors to think about. First, consider how big your kids are and what size mattress they will require. Also, ensure that you have enough room in your home for a bunk bed including the space to get up and down from the top.

Many families choose twin-over-twin bunk beds for their children. They provide the luxury of two twin mattresses while taking up half as much floor space as traditional full-size beds. They are also a great choice for children who have friends coming over for a sleep over. Some models also have an trundle that is placed on the bottom bunk, allowing you to add a spare mattress for sleepovers without taking up too much room in the bedroom.

A loft bunk bed is a different option. The lower portion of the bed can be used as a desk or even a play area. The lower level is equipped with storage space for toys and clothes. Many bunk beds have stairs or ladders to reach the top level. Some even include storage on the stairs.

Some bunk beds have a futon at the bottom and a bed at the top. This allows the possibility of using the bed as a sofa during the day and as a couch during the night. This is a great option for children who are transitioning from toddler to child beds or for children who prefer the comfort of a sofa, but the ease of beds.

The most spacious bunk beds come with a twin over full arrangement, which is great for kids who require more room for growth or who share the same room with siblings who are of different age. Certain frames can be adapted to accommodate twin XL mattresses which is five inches larger than a standard twin mattress, to accommodate taller children.

Safety

Safety should be the main aspect when buying bunk beds for kids. While the thought of children sharing a bed may be thrilling however, you must take security precautions to ensure the safety of your child. Make sure that the bunk bed is approved and meets all safety standards of the nation. Also, pay attention to the materials used in the construction of the bunk bed, as certain materials are more hazardous than others.

The first step to ensure bunk bed safety is to make sure that the mattress is of sufficient dimensions and is placed correctly. This will decrease the risk of injury and entrapment. Additionally, it is important to teach your children not to climb on the top bed and to use the ladder carefully. It is also recommended to get your children to play safely around the bunk beds and to keep their toys out of the ladder area.

A guardrail on either side of the bunk bed is another important safety measure. These rails must be at minimum 3.5" wide and extend five inches above the mattress. This will prevent your child from falling off the top childrens bunk beds, posing a risk of death by suffocation.

It is also important to ensure that the bunk beds are away from any potential dangers in the room such as ceiling fans, heaters and lighting fixtures. This will reduce the risk of your children running over them or falling and ensure that they are able to get away from the top buy bunk beds if necessary.

The final important safety feature of bunk beds is to stop your children from playing rough on or around the beds. This could result in injuries, like head injuries or broken wrists. Encourage your child to use the ladder only for climbing up or down the bunk bed.

Also, make sure to check regularly the bunk bed for signs of wear or damage. Also, be sure to tighten all screws, bolts and connections. This will ensure that the bunk bed is secure and safe.
